Do zero ao avançado: Processadores aplicados à Computação em Nuvem

Do zero ao avançado: Processadores aplicados à Computação em Nuvem

A Importância dos Processadores na Computação em Nuvem

Os processadores são componentes cruciais na infraestrutura de computação em nuvem, pois são responsáveis por executar as instruções de software e realizar cálculos. Na nuvem, a escolha do processador pode impactar diretamente a performance, a escalabilidade e a eficiência dos serviços oferecidos. Os principais tipos de processadores utilizados incluem CPUs (Unidades Centrais de Processamento) e GPUs (Unidades de Processamento Gráfico), cada um com suas características e aplicações específicas.

Tipos de Processadores e Suas Aplicações

CPUs

As CPUs são projetadas para executar uma ampla gama de tarefas e são ideais para aplicações que exigem processamento sequencial. Elas são frequentemente usadas em servidores que hospedam aplicações web, bancos de dados e sistemas de gerenciamento de conteúdo.

GPUs

Por outro lado, as GPUs são otimizadas para realizar cálculos paralelos, o que as torna ideais para tarefas como aprendizado de máquina, processamento de imagens e renderização gráfica. Com o aumento da demanda por inteligência artificial e big data, as GPUs têm se tornado cada vez mais populares na computação em nuvem.

Critérios de Escolha de Processadores

1. Performance

A performance do processador é um dos critérios mais importantes. É essencial avaliar a capacidade de processamento em relação às necessidades específicas da aplicação. Por exemplo, aplicações que requerem alto desempenho em cálculos matemáticos complexos podem se beneficiar mais de GPUs.

2. Custo

O custo é um fator determinante na escolha do processador. É importante considerar não apenas o preço de aquisição, mas também os custos operacionais, como consumo de energia e refrigeração. Processadores mais eficientes podem oferecer economia a longo prazo.

3. Escalabilidade

A escalabilidade é fundamental para garantir que a infraestrutura possa crescer conforme a demanda. Processadores que suportam virtualização e podem ser facilmente integrados em clusters são preferíveis em ambientes de nuvem.

4. Compatibilidade

A compatibilidade com o software e a infraestrutura existente é outro aspecto a ser considerado. Certifique-se de que o processador escolhido seja suportado pelas plataformas e ferramentas que você pretende utilizar.

Riscos Associados ao Uso de Processadores na Nuvem

1. Segurança

Os processadores podem ser vulneráveis a ataques, como o Spectre e Meltdown, que exploram falhas de segurança. É crucial manter o firmware e o software atualizados para mitigar esses riscos.

2. Dependência de Fornecedores

A escolha de um fornecedor de nuvem pode criar dependências que dificultam a migração para outras plataformas. Avalie cuidadosamente as condições e os termos de serviço antes de se comprometer.

3. Desempenho Variável

O desempenho pode variar com base na carga de trabalho e na configuração do ambiente. É importante monitorar continuamente o desempenho e estar preparado para ajustar a infraestrutura conforme necessário.

Sinais de Alerta para Problemas com Processadores

  • Aumento no tempo de resposta: Se as aplicações começam a apresentar lentidão, pode ser um sinal de que o processador não está atendendo à demanda.
  • Consumo elevado de recursos: Monitorar o uso de CPU e memória pode ajudar a identificar gargalos.
  • Erros frequentes: Mensagens de erro ou falhas inesperadas podem indicar problemas de hardware ou software relacionados ao processador.

Boas Práticas na Escolha de Processadores para Nuvem

  • Realizar testes de desempenho: Antes de implementar um novo processador, conduza testes para avaliar sua performance em cenários reais.
  • Optar por soluções escaláveis: Escolha processadores que permitam fácil expansão e adaptação às mudanças nas necessidades de negócios.
  • Manter-se atualizado: A tecnologia de processadores evolui rapidamente; mantenha-se informado sobre novas opções e melhorias.

Conclusão

A escolha do processador certo é fundamental para garantir uma infraestrutura de computação em nuvem eficiente e segura. Considerar aspectos como performance, custo, escalabilidade e segurança ajuda a minimizar riscos e maximizar benefícios. Ao seguir boas práticas e estar atento a sinais de alerta, é possível otimizar a utilização de processadores na nuvem, garantindo que as aplicações atendam às expectativas e necessidades dos usuários.

FAQ

Quais são os principais tipos de processadores usados na nuvem?

Os principais tipos são CPUs e GPUs, cada um adequado para diferentes tipos de tarefas.

Como posso garantir a segurança dos processadores na nuvem?

Mantenha o firmware atualizado e implemente práticas de segurança robustas para mitigar vulnerabilidades.

O que devo considerar ao escolher um fornecedor de nuvem?

Avalie a compatibilidade, custos, escalabilidade e a reputação do fornecedor em relação à segurança e suporte técnico.

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.

Sobre o autor

Editorial Ti do Mundo

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.

Transparencia editorial

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.

Contato via formulario, com retorno por email.

Comentários

Comentários estarão disponíveis em breve.

Artigos relacionados